Full Interview: ICE agents "beat up" man outside of Costco in Central Texas - CBS Austin



HAYS COUNTY, Texas — Federal immigration enforcement operations were underway in Kyle and Buda on Thursday, with local officials confirming the activity but emphasizing they were not involved. One person was injured during detainment.

Local officials say they had no advance notice. Hays County Judge Ruben Becerra says ICE agents had planned to park a transport bus on Thursday morning. He says the city asked them to move — and now many people are asking questions about ICE activity in the area.

“It's clearly shown everywhere in the United States that they're doing whatever they want because they can," said Judge Becerra. They tried to park in the Buda City Hall, and the Buda City Hall said, no thank you. Keep moving.”

Judge Becerra says he received no notice that ICE was going to be operating in his county on Thursday.
